Do not worry about Brunei. Their vast oil wealth is going to be gone in 20 years. Since they pegged their Brunei Ringgit to One SGD, In twenty years they would be a wholly owned subsidary of Singapore. They are going to suffer the same consequences of Chevism as they refuse to diversify. They are no longer seen as rich bastards anymore like they have been for 30 years. Brunei's perceived success is only seen as they made an economic Pact with developing Singapore back then. It was pretty simple: Brunei supplies Singapore Oil and Singapore refines it and ships it across Asia-Pacific. They used to monopolize the whole Singaporean incoming oil supply. However, as of late they have their oil supply has declined. Now it is the Middle eastern oil supply that dominates Singapore's refineries. Also, it is the Sultanate that owns the mineral rights and the Brunei Oil MNCs subsidaries. So technically Brunei is having a richer rich class and poorer poor class. Brunei's economic system is failing. Especially with volatile oil prices, I can predict Brunei would not make it come 2050 and would probably beeen sold to the Malaysians by Singaporeans who have already turned Brunei into a financial puppet
